2. Incorporating Balance Exercises to Prevent Falls in Older Adults

Our balance can worsen as we age, making it easier for older people to fall. The good news is that adding balance exercises to your routine can help reduce this risk and make you more stable. Easy exercises like standing on one leg, walking heel-to-toe, and tai chi can help balance and coordination.

Here are some benefits of doing balance exercises:

  • Lower chance of falling
  • Better stability and coordination
  • More confidence in daily activities

If you have any medical conditions, it is essential to talk to your healthcare provider before starting any new exercise programs.

3. Strength Training Techniques Tailored for Seniors

Strength training is not only for young people; it also has many benefits for seniors. Regular strength training exercises can help improve bone density, build muscle, increase metabolism, and enhance overall strength.

However, seniors should be considered when starting strength training. It’s essential to work with experienced personal trainers in NY who understand the specific needs of older adults.

These trainers can create personalized workout plans, ensure exercises are done correctly and safely, and slowly increase the intensity to match each person's fitness level.

Qualifications to Look For in a Personal Trainer

When picking a personal trainer, make sure they have recognized certifications. This shows they know what they are doing. Look for certifications from ACSM, the American Council on Exercise (ACE), the National Sports Medicine Institute (NASM), or the International Sports Sciences Association (ISSA).

It is also important for trainers to have experience with clients who have similar goals or issues. If you are a senior, find a trainer specializing in fitness for seniors.

Lastly, choose trainers who communicate well. Good communication helps create a friendly and supportive training space.

How often should seniors exercise to see benefits?

Seniors should get at least 150 minutes of moderate or 75 minutes of medium to challenging exercise each week, spread out over the week. They should also include two strength training sessions.

Can balance exercises really prevent falls?

Consistent balance exercises can help lower the risk of falls. They improve stability, coordination, and awareness of our body’s position. This is important, especially as we age and our balance worsens.
